Jul. 23--Buffalo Niagara home sale prices hit an all-time high in June.
The average price of a home sold last month was $105,180, beating the previous record of $104,870 set in December 1994, according to the Buffalo Niagara Association of Realtors. The news comes on the heels of May, when the average home sale price was at a seven-year high.
"This builds equity for people," said A. Bruce Wilson, the association's executive director. "Whether they want to sell or not."
